Flight Reservation for Turkey Visa
A flight reservation for Turkey visa is a temporary, verifiable airline itinerary used to show your travel plans. It allows you to apply for a visa without purchasing a full ticket.
Do You Need a Flight Reservation for Turkey Visa?
Yes, in most cases a flight reservation is required to demonstrate your travel plans when applying for a Turkey visa.
- Shows intended travel dates
- Confirms entry and exit
- Supports visa application
For e-visa applications, it may not always be mandatory but is recommended.

What Is a Flight Reservation for Turkey Visa?
A flight reservation is a temporary airline booking with a real PNR. It is used for visa applications and is not a paid ticket.
Is It Verifiable?
- Includes real airline PNR
- Can be checked on airline systems
- Accepted for visa and travel proof
Why Not Buy a Ticket Before Visa Approval?
- Risk of visa refusal
- Cancellation charges
- Refund delays
- Non-refundable fares
